A spark plug ignition coil plays a crucial role in the functioning of an internal combustion engine. It is responsible for generating the high voltage needed to create a spark within the combustion chamber, igniting the air-fuel mixture and initiating the power stroke. Without a properly functioning ignition coil, the engine would not be able to start or run efficiently.

As an example, this oil seal has a part number that corresponds to a Shaft Size of 3”, a Bore Size of 4”, a Width Size of 0.625”, a Style of TB2, and is made of Viton material. Conversely, the same size oil seal in Metric has a Shaft Size of 76.20 mm, a Bore Size of 101.60 mm, and a Width Size of 15.88 mm.
